    The following is from a 2008 article regarding a proposal that would have allowed trained professors and students to carry while on campus. Unfortunately, the bill went nowhere. Would it have prevented today's tragedy? Maybe, maybe not, but we'll never know.



    "Alabama's public universities, like most colleges around the country, ban guns on campus.
    Erwin's bills would have allowed professors with the proper gun permits to carry their weapons on public college campuses. The bills also would have allowed students to carry guns, provided they met a long lists of requirements, including having the proper permits, completing a gun skills course approved by the university, and participating in the campus' ROTC military training program.
    Erwin said the bills were designed to discourage gunmen by making them aware someone could shoot back quickly."
